Ten Favourite Films of 2003

Aleksandr Sokurov's "Russian Ark"

Here’s another unit from In Review Online’s Yearbook project: my pick for the 10 outstanding movies of 2003, which was a very good year indeed. I had a hard time narrowing things down to this handful of titles. Films are listed in alphabetical order, and ‘year’ is determined over at InRO by a movie’s first US release, limited or wide (not festivals or exclusive screenings).

28 Days Later…, directed by Danny Boyle (UK)

The Company, directed by Robert Altman (US)

demonlover, directed by Olivier Assayas (France)

Flowers of Evil, directed by Claude Chabrol (France)

Hotel, directed by Mike Figgis (UK)

Lost in Translation, directed by Sofia Coppola (US)

Millennium Mambo, directed by Hou Hsiao-hsien (Taiwan)

Russian Ark, directed by Aleksandr Sokurov (Russia)

Ten, directed by Abbas Kiarostami (Iran)

Unknown Pleasures, directed by Jia Zhang-ke (China)
